Summary Of A Letter to God

Lencho, a poor farmer, lives with his family on a small farm located in a valley. He relies on his crops for survival, and his entire harvest depends on timely rain. One year, after a long period of drought, his prayers are answered when it finally starts to rain. However, the joy is short-lived as the rain quickly turns into a destructive hailstorm, destroying his crops entirely.

Devastated, Lencho feels hopeless, but his strong faith in God gives him an idea. He writes a letter to God, asking for 100 pesos to help him survive and replant his crops. Lencho believes that only God can help him in this difficult time.

He takes the letter to the post office and, amused by Lencho’s faith, the postmaster and his colleagues decide to help. They collect 70 pesos and put it in an envelope addressed to Lencho, pretending it’s from God.

When Lencho receives the money, instead of feeling grateful, he becomes angry. He believes that God sent him the full amount, but the postal employees must have stolen 30 pesos. He writes another letter to God, requesting the rest of the money and warning Him not to send it through the post office, as the employees there are "crooks."
